text/scanner: rename AllowNumberbars to AllowDigitSeparators
Fixes #32661. Change-Id: I32dc4e7b276b95ac2e87a384caa6c48702368d05 Reviewed-on: https://go-review.googlesource.com/c/go/+/183077 Reviewed-by: Andrew Bonventre <andybons@golang.org>
